Output 8980f8dba7252cc975b7a06117d1c23f790e4a18325a56ea0eab598db0e08ab6:0

value
81565466
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ca9038af98c8f2cdc86dc55b7658f03b828ba08 OP_EQUAL
address
37DkwLjQm3ZUH6EqBtwjtAYc2FVKePqmps
transaction
8980f8dba7252cc975b7a06117d1c23f790e4a18325a56ea0eab598db0e08ab6
spent
true